There's no such thing as a "family pack" license for OS X Server. Server has to be the OS *inside* the VM.

Given the cost of OS X Server licenses ($499 a pop) for something like testing web browsers you're almost certainly better off mounting a shelf in a data center rack, covering it with the cheapest Mac Minis you can buy ($599), and enabling VNC on them all than you are buying an Xserve+virtualizer+OS X Server licenses. Starting with the hardware, an 8-core Xserve with 24GB of RAM will put you $4600 bucks in the hole. VMware Fusion still doesn't seem to *explicitly* "support " OS X guests, so let's tack on $1250 for a Parallels Server license (which does explicitly support OS X Server guests.). Simple math at this point determines that you'll have to be able to run 58 simultaneous OS X Server guests to match the price-per-session of OS X minis. Certainly when you factor in the network ports and additional rack space/power for the minis it might change things somewhat, but since you're really *not* going to be able to run 58 sessions at once on a single Xserve the equation is still pretty bad. Might as well just buy a Mini for every developer and call it a day.
